All rights reserved. http://www.usgwarchives.org/copyright.htm http://www.usgwarchives.org/va/vafiles.htm ************************************************ HILLARY LEE VAUGHAN Hillary Lee Vaughan, 75, a well-known farmer of the Franklin community, died Sunday morning, March 25, in Raiford Memorial Hospital after undergoing an operation on the previous Friday. Mr. Vaughan was the son of the late James Henry and Missouri Anne Joyner Vaughan of Southampton county and husband of Mrs. Mary Jane Gardner Vaughan, who survives him. He was a member of Sycamore Baptist Church and of the Woodman of the World. Besides his wife he is survived by three daughters, Mrs. J. Edward Howell of Franklin, Mrs. Charles Darden of Portsmouth, and Mrs. J.W. Marshall of Richmond; three sons, Hudson Leroy Vaughan, Henry Cecil Vaughan and Ashley N. Vaughan, all of the community; 11 grandchildren and one great-grandchild; a brother, J.R. Vaughan of Franklin; one sister, Mrs. Addie Blythe of Handsom; and several nieces and nephews. Funeral services for Mr. Vaughan were held from the late residence at 2:30 o’clock Tuesday afternoon, with Revs. L. M. Kanipe and R. D. Stephenson officiating. Interment was in Poplar Spring Cemetery, the pallbearers being Lawless Cobb, W.O. Cotton, Hunter Darden, Ryland Edwards, Elmer Harcum, Shelley Joyner, E.P. Lowe and T.K. Monahan. [Hillary Lee VAUGHAN, d. 25 Mar 1951, age 75, interred in Poplar Spring Cemetery, Franklin, 27 Mar 1951, "The Tidewater News" (Franklin, VA), obit Mar. 30, 1951] [file transcribed by Mrs. Bruce Saunders (bs4403@verizon.net), and re-formatted by File Manager.]
